The Zen of AirBnB Cleaning: Incorporating Mindfulness into Your AirBnB Routine
Cleaning is often framed as a task to “get through.” Something between check-out and check-in. A necessity rather than a pleasure. But what if cleaning could become something else entirely?
When approached mindfully, cleaning transforms from a chore into a calming ritual. It becomes a moment of presence, clarity, and connection with your AirBnB space.
Even better, this mindset shift benefits not only you, but also the guests who step into the environment you’ve prepared.
Why Mindful Cleaning Matters
Mindfulness is about being fully present in what you’re doing. No rushing. No mental noise. No autopilot.
Applied to cleaning, mindfulness helps you:
- Reduce stress and mental clutter
- Feel more connected to your property
- Improve attention to detail
- Create a more peaceful guest environment
- Enjoy the process rather than resent it
A calm cleaner creates a calm space.

14. Connect with Your Space
Mindful cleaning deepens your relationship with your property.
You begin to notice:
- Small repairs needed
- Layout improvements
- Decorative adjustments
- Wear and tear patterns
Mindfulness naturally improves property care.
